Wood Characteristics to Think About



When selecting timber for custom cupboards, take into consideration the toughness, grain pattern, and color choices offered to guarantee the perfect fit for your task.

Oak is a popular selection known for its toughness and noticeable grain. It's durable and flexible, making it ideal for different designs.

Maple is another durable option with a smooth grain that's suitable for repainted finishes.

Cherry timber uses an abundant, warm shade that dims with age, adding beauty to any kind of area.

If you like an even more unique look, take into consideration mahogany for its reddish-brown color and elegant feeling.

For a contemporary touch, walnut gives a sophisticated dark brownish color with a straight grain pattern.

Matching Wood to Closet Design



To ensure your custom-made cabinets attain a cohesive and aesthetically enticing appearance, it's essential to meticulously match the timber type to the style of the cabinets you want. Different wood species can considerably affect the overall aesthetic of your cabinets. For a more typical feeling, think about using timbers like oak or cherry, which provide cozy tones and elaborate grain patterns. These timbers match well with traditional cupboard styles such as increased panel or shaker layouts.

If bathroom cabinetry layout favor a more contemporary appearance, opt for woods like maple or birch that have a smoother texture and lighter color tones. These timbers complement contemporary cupboard designs such as flat-panel or slab doors. Additionally, unique timbers like teak wood or mahogany can add a touch of deluxe and originality to your personalized closets, ideal for high end or custom-made rooms.

Budget-Friendly Wood Options



Think about cost-efficient wood alternatives like pine or poplar for your custom-made closets if you're functioning within a budget plan. While these timbers may not have the same lavish charm as much more pricey options, they can still supply an attractive and functional outcome.

Pine is a preferred option for budget-friendly cupboards as a result of its cost and convenience. It has a light shade with noticeable grain patterns that can add a rustic charm to your room.



Poplar is an additional economical choice that provides a smoother texture and the capacity to take discolorations and finishes well. Both want and poplar are conveniently available, making them hassle-free choices for custom-made cabinet projects on a budget.

Remember that while these timbers are cost-effective, they may be softer than woods like oak or maple, so they may be extra susceptible to damages and scratches. However, with proper care and upkeep, closets made from pine or poplar can still stand the test of time while keeping your project within budget.
